The Unvarnished Truth of Entrepreneurship

  • 💡 Ben Horowitz, a Silicon Valley veteran and co-founder of Andreessen Horowitz, offers a raw, unfiltered look at the challenges of building and leading a business.
  • 🎯 His book, "The Hard Thing About Hard Things," dives into the brutal realities of startups, emphasizing that there are no easy answers for the tough decisions leaders face.
  • 🧠 Unlike typical business books, it focuses on the messy, complex realities of leadership, drawing from Horowitz's experiences as CEO of Opsware (formerly Loudcloud).

Navigating "The Struggle"

  • ⚠️ A central theme is "the Struggle," the emotional and psychological toll of running a company, including self-doubt, fear, and isolation.
  • 📈 Horowitz argues that this struggle is universal for leaders and embracing it helps build character and sharpens decision-making.
  • 🔑 The book provides real advice for a tumultuous journey, cutting through romanticized notions of entrepreneurship to prepare leaders for relentless challenges.

Making Difficult Decisions

  • 🛠️ Leaders frequently face "hard things" like firing executives, laying off employees, or pivoting business models, which are rarely clear-cut.
  • 🚀 Horowitz recounts his decision to pivot Loudcloud from a software product to a services model, which required significant layoffs and emotional toll.
  • ✅ His approach emphasizes gathering data, trusting instincts, and acting decisively even when outcomes are uncertain, drawing from real-world examples.

Building a Resilient Organization

  • 🌱 The book offers practical advice on hiring, culture, and scaling, stressing the importance of building a resilient company culture.
  • 🤝 Horowitz advocates for hiring for strengths and cultural fit, aligning talent with the company's stage, and fostering a transparent culture to unify teams.
  • 💬 He emphasizes open communication and feedback, including regular one-on-one meetings, to build trust and ensure team alignment on company goals.
